Class AnimationSplineBuilder

Class AnimationSplineBuilder

ja nimityö: Aspose.Svg.Builder Kokous: Aspose.SVG.dll (25.5.0)

Rakentaja-luokka animaation ajoitustoimintojen rakentamiseen käyttämällä kuutioisia Bézier-kerroksia.Tämä luokka mahdollistaa yhden tai useamman Bézier-kuubikohdan määritelmän, joista kukin on määritelty kahdella ohjauspisteellä.Tuloksena oleva sarja voidaan käyttää CSS-animaatioissa tai siirtymissä animaation nopeuden hallitsemiseksi.

[ComVisible(true)]
public class AnimationSplineBuilder

Inheritance

object AnimationSplineBuilder

Perintöjäsenet

object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Constructors

AnimationSplineBuilder()

public AnimationSplineBuilder()

Methods

AddSpline(kaksinkertainen, kaksinkertainen, kaksinkertainen)

Lisää kuutioinen Bézier-kurva animaatioon.

public AnimationSplineBuilder AddSpline(double x1, double y1, double x2, double y2)

Parameters

x1 double

Ensimmäisen ohjauspisteen x-koordinaatti.

y1 double

Y-koordinaatti ensimmäisestä ohjauspisteestä.

x2 double

Toisen ohjauspisteen x-koordinaatti.

y2 double

Y-koordinaatti toisesta ohjauspisteestä.

Returns

AnimationSplineBuilder

Nykyinen tapaus AnimationSplineBuilderin menetelmän ketjuun.

Build()

Rakentaa animaation spline arvoa sarjaksi.

public string Build()

Returns

string

Animaation spline, joka sopii CSS: ssä käytettäväksi.

 Suomi